ANITom Cruise’s Top Gun 3 Announced: Tom Cruise fans have a reason to rejoice as Paramount Pictures has brought in good news with the announcement of "Top Gun 3" which is officially happening. Cruise is set to return as daring pilot Pete "Maverick" Mitchell. The announcement came Thursday (April 16, 2026) at the studio's showcase at CinemaCon, an annual week-long summit at which Hollywood studios present their biggest upcoming movies to theater owners and press.
Paramount film co-head Josh Greenstein said "Top Gun 3" was "officially in development with a script well underway," adding that Cruise would reunite with producer Jerry Bruckheimer on the project, as reported by news agency AFP. Joseph Kosinski, who directed the second installment of the hit franchise, may return to direct and produce, but as of now 'Top Gun 3' does not yet have an official director attached or a confirmed release date.
The original 1986 film helped propel Tom Cruise to superstardom, while its long-awaited 2022 sequel went on to earn $1.5 billion worldwide, with legendary director Steven Spielberg publicly crediting the veteran actor for helping bring moviegoers back to theaters after the Covid-19 pandemic.
Cruise was not present during the presentation, but did narrate a film used to open the event, which focused on the studio's commitment to releasing films on the big screen. At the end, Cruise, sitting atop the water tower on the studio's lot, says, "The future looks great from here."
Paramount Skydance chief David Ellison told attendees that the studio would guarantee a 45-day theatrical release window for its films before moving them to streaming platforms.
"Once we combine with Warner Brothers, we're going to make a minimum of 30 films annually," Ellison said in a pledge to theater owners. "Long live the movies." Paramount has launched a massive $111 billion bid to take over Warner Bros, topping a rival bid from Netflix.
